What Is the Average Salary of a Software Engineer at Capital One?

The compensation that software engineers receive in this company depends on the experience you have, the level of your job, and the geographical area. Based on the information that I have gathered from Glassdoor and other average salary-providing sites, here is how it looks:

Entry-Level (Software Engineer I)

  • Base Salary: $95,000 – $120,000 per year
  • Total Annual Package (incl Bonuses & Stock): Around $105,000 – $130,000

It is for entry-level employees or anybody with up to two years of working experience in the information technology field. Overall, the remuneration package has a good pay grade; it is proportional to what reputable companies that traverse both the financial and technological sectors offer.

Mid-Level (Software Engineer II / Senior Software Engineer)

  • Base Salary: $125,000 – $150,000 per year
  • Total Compensation: Around $140,000 – $170,000

This level of engineer is usually expected to have 3-5 years of experience in the field. With more experience, they tackle more challenging tasks than those given to junior developers; they also help in systems development.

Senior & Lead Engineers (Principal & Distinguished Engineer Levels)

  • Base Salary: $160,000 – $200,000 per year
  • Total Compensation: $180,000 – $250,000+

Mechanical and engineering employees who have some years of experience and switch to managerial positions also earn better remuneration. During this stage, the professionals are involved in designing huge systems, managing teams, and making key technology decisions.

How Does Compensation Compare to Other Tech Companies?

With these numbers of the current year at hand, the next logical question would be how these numbers fare with other companies. Obviously, it is evident that Capital One offers a good salary, but the question is, does it surpass those of other leading tech companies?

Below is the information about the salaries of mid-level software engineers at various companies:

CompanyAverage Base SalaryTotal Compensation
Capital One$130K – $150K$140K – $170K
Amazon$145K – $160K$160K – $200K
Google$150K – $170K$180K – $220K
Microsoft$135K – $150K$150K – $180K
JP Morgan Chase$120K – $140K$130K – $160K

From the following table it may also be noted that as for the salaries, Capital One is not too bad as it may be… They are still more than the remunerations that many traditional finance companies offer their employees.

What Benefits and Perks Does Capital One Offer?

Other things being equal, higher pay is always good, but the other forms of compensation can mean so much to an employee. These are some of the other benefits that are associated with employment within this company:

  • Annual Performance Bonuses (typically 5% – 15% of base salary)
  • Stock Options (RSUs) for Mid-Level and Senior Engineers
  • 401(k) Matching up to 7%
  • Health Insurance with Competitive Coverage
  • Generous Paid Time Off and Parental Leave
  • Education Reimbursement & Learning Stipends
  • Remote & Hybrid Work Options (Varies by Role and Location)
